Speaking of Johnson being drafted, always kind of interesting to look back and see what the "experts" were saying when he was being evaluated. Pretty spot on:

Quote :
"

2007 NFL Draft Prospect Scouting Report:
Charles Johnson, DE, Georgia

Charles Johnson had a sensational junior year at Georgia, registering 19 tackles for a loss and 9.5 sacks. Johnson and teammate Quentin Moses made a dynamic combination at defensive end for Georgia. With his stock value rising, Johnson elected to forego his senior year and enter the 2007 draft.

Johnson is shorter that you would hope for a defensive end, but does have the ideal size in terms of weight (275 lbs) for a pass rushing end in the NFL. He is very solid against the run and effective closing down the running lanes and forcing the ball carrier to the inside. Johnson brings an excellent burst from the edge to get around the offensive tackle and create havoc in the backfield. He also has exceptional strength to overpower most blockers and closing speed to get to the quarterback. Johnson uses his hands well and his low center of gravity to leverage position against opposing blockers.

His inexperience, consistency and tendency to wear down late in the game are concerns to scouts. Many believe he excelled early in the season due to his teammate, Quentin Moses, drawing most of the attention from offensive blocking schemes. Some teams have discussed the possibility of moving him to outside linebacker, but that remains to be seen. Regardless of the concerns, Johnson has a ton of talent and ability to perform at the next level. Johnson made the right decision to declare for the draft and should be a mid-to-late first round pick. "

signed DT Ron Edwards

Quote :
"Yes, John Fox is gone from Carolina. But it looks like the Panthers are going back to the philosophy they followed in his early years.

They’re building around the defensive line. A day after agreeing to terms on a deal that will keep defensive end Charles Johnson with the team, the Panthers have addressed what’s been a glaring weakness in recent years. They just went out and spent some decent money on a defensive tackle in free agency.

They’ve agreed to terms with former Kansas City defensive tackle Ron Edwards, according to Adam Schefter. Edwards has agreed to a three-year deal worth $8.25 million.

Edwards is a pure run-stopper and that’s something the Panthers need. He’s never had more than four sacks in a season, but the Panthers can get those from Johnson and others. They’re bringing in Edwards, 32, to help solidify the run defense.

He’ll act as a bridge and give rookies Terrell McClain and Sione Fua some time to develop."
